Gun Video DVD – IDPA Shooting Competition X0169D Review

The Gun Video DVD – IDPA Shooting Competition X0169D in Action: First Look

The Gun Video DVD – IDPA Shooting Competition X0169D promises an in-depth look at the International Defensive Pistol Association (IDPA) shooting sport. Gun Video aims to provide viewers with an understanding of self-defense tactics and the practical application of handguns within a competitive environment. This DVD features shooting business experts like Bill Wilson, Ken Hackathorn, and many more.

Breaking Down the Features of Gun Video DVD – IDPA Shooting Competition X0169D

Specifications

  • Manufacturer: Gun Video. This provides a standard of quality and assurance that the content is professionally produced and vetted.
  • Media Format: DVD. This familiar format offers ease of playback on most DVD players and computers.
  • Language: English. This ensures broad accessibility for English-speaking audiences.
  • Featured Experts: Bill Wilson, Ken Hackathorn, Dick Thomas, Chip McCormick, John Nowlin, John Sayle, Walt Rauch, Lenny Magill, and many others. These leading figures in the shooting world lend credibility and a wealth of knowledge to the DVD.
